Write in point-slope form an equation of the line that passes through the point (3,0) with slope 23.
Radda [10]

Answer:

y-0=23(x-3)

Step-by-step explanation:

Point-slope form: y-y_1=m(x-x_1) when the given point is (x_1,y_1) and m is the slope

y-y_1=m(x-x_1)

Plug in the point

y-0=m(x-3)

Plug in the slope

y-0=23(x-3)

Which is equivalent to RootIndex 3 StartRoot 8 EndRoot Superscript one-fourth x?
Nat2105 [25]
<h3>Answer: Choice C</h3>

RootIndex 12 StartRoot 8 EndRoot Superscript x

12th root of 8^x = (12th root of 8)^x

\sqrt[12]{8^{x}} = \left(\sqrt[12]{8}\right)^{x}

=========================================

Explanation:

The general rule is

\sqrt[n]{x} = x^{1/n}

so any nth root is the same as having a fractional exponent 1/n.

Using that rule we can say the cube root of 8 is equivalent to 8^(1/3)

\sqrt[3]{8} = 8^{1/3}

-----

Raising this to the power of (1/4)x will have us multiply the exponents of 1/3 and (1/4)x like so

(1/3)*(1/4)x = (1/12)x

In other words,

\left(8^{1/3}\right)^{(1/4)x} = 8^{(1/3)*(1/4)x}

\left(8^{1/3}\right)^{(1/4)x} = 8^{(1/12)x}

-----

From here, we rewrite the fractional exponent 1/12 as a 12th root. which leads us to this

8^{(1/12)x} = \sqrt[12]{8^{x}}

8^{(1/12)x} = \left(\sqrt[12]{8}\right)^{x}
